Cardiac arrhythmia assessment with patch electrocardiogram versus insertable cardiac monitor: a cohort study in endurance athletes with atrial fibrillation

Cardiac Arrhythmia Assessment in Endurance Athletes

Study Overview

This study compared two methods for tracking heart rhythm in endurance athletes with atrial fibrillation (AF). It aimed to evaluate how well a patch electrocardiogram (ECG) detects heart issues compared to a more established insertable cardiac monitor.

Study Design

It was a prospective cohort study involving endurance athletes diagnosed with paroxysmal AF, who were taking part in a controlled trial on training effects.

Participants

Twenty-nine non-elite endurance athletes received the patch ECG device (ECG247 Smart Heart Sensor) to monitor heart rhythms continuously. They were also monitored with the insertable cardiac monitor (Confirm Rx, Abbott).

Key Findings

  • Only 14 athletes (average age 60.4 years) used the patch ECG, totaling 2987 hours of monitoring over an average of 14 days.
  • During this time, athletes completed 112 training sessions.
  • Recording quality varied: 16% poor quality during cross-country skiing and 40% during running.
  • The patch ECG detected AF episodes that were confirmed by the insertable monitor.
  • One technical issue led to a false alarm for ventricular tachycardia.

Conclusion

Patch ECG monitoring was effective for endurance athletes; however, recording quality fluctuated based on the individual and type of exercise.

Trial Registration

This study is registered under NCT04991337 as part of a related randomized controlled trial.
